About

Qinbin Zhang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Nutrition and Dietet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Qinbin Zhang has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 570 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 3 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ics. Recurrent topics in Qinbin Zhang's work include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(3 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(3 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(2 papers). Qinbin Zhang is often cited by papers focused on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(3 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(3 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(2 papers). Qinbin Zhang collaborates with scholars based in China, British Virgin Islands and United States. Qinbin Zhang's co-authors include Lan Wen, Jingxi Ma, Keming Zhang, Xiaolin Wu, Jiani Li, Wei Wang, Changqing Li, Huan Ma, Kai Su and Qiang Yu and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ications and Frontiers in Plant Science.
